自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(55)
  • 资源 (1)
  • 问答 (2)
  • 收藏
  • 关注

uniVocity-parsers:一款强大的CSV/TSV/定宽文本文件解析库(Java)

[url=http://www.univocity.com/pages/about-parsers]uniVocity-parsers[/url] 是一个开源的Java项目。 针对CSV/TSV/定宽文本文件的解析,它以简洁的API开发接口提供了丰富而强大的功能。后面会做进一步介绍。和其他解析库有所不同,uniVocity-parsers以高性能、可扩展为出发点,设计了一套自有架构。基于这...

2015-04-27 00:21:55 455

原创 sssssssssssssssssss

testsssssssssssssssssssssssssss

2015-01-17 16:51:28 562

Crontab和Linux日期相关的tips

好久没有在Javaeye上写东西了,今天碰到一个Linux下schedule任务的问题,记录一下。crontab分系统级和用户级,系统级的crontab配置文件在/etc/crontab,crontab预定义的定时任务类别分别有:/etc/crontab.hourly, /etc/crontab.daily, /etc/crontab.weekly, /etc/cronta...

2010-11-26 22:27:14 257

Java压缩和解压缩

压缩需求:压缩文件夹下所有具有统一文件名规范的普通文件,同时添加文件名与压缩包相同的MANIFEST文件,包含所有被压缩文件的文件名及大小列表。Java文件压缩涉及到的类均在java.uti.zip包下:[list][*]ZipOutputStream: Zip包的输出流,利用putNextEntry()向包内添加一个文件。[*]ZipEntry: 将被压缩到包内的文件实例,在文件...

2010-06-17 18:40:53 160

My douban

[flash=300,450]http://www.douban.com/doushow/idealab/collection___8_2__logo_self/doushow.swf[/flash][flash=300,400]http://www.douban.com/swf/radio_widget.swf?doubanid=idealab&maxresults=3 [/flash]

2010-03-12 16:36:35 115

原创 【转】深入浅出之正则表达式(二)

[quote]本文转自:[url=http://dragon.cnblogs.com/archive/2006/05/09/394923.html]博客园摩诘作品[/url] 本文讲解精细,涉及到了正则表达式的基础/引擎/匹配机制/各种特性以及表达式编写技巧,值得研究。[/quote][b]9. 单词边界[/b] 元字符也是一种对位置进行匹配的“锚”。这种匹配是0长度匹配。有...

2010-03-05 16:11:23 107

原创 【转】深入浅出之正则表达式(一)

[quote]本文转自:[url=http://dragon.cnblogs.com/archive/2006/05/08/394078.html]博客园摩诘作品[/url]本文讲解精细,涉及到了正则表达式的基础/引擎/匹配机制/各种特性以及表达式编写技巧,值得研究。[/quote]前言: 半年前我对正则表达式产生了兴趣,在网上查找过不少资料,看过不少的教程,最后在使用一个...

2010-03-05 16:00:04 123

原创 pkg-config工具, ld.so.conf文件, PKG_CONFIG_PATH环境变量

原文地址:[url]www.91linux.com/html/article/program/cpp/20071207/8934.html[/url]一、编译和连接 一般来说,如果库的头文件不在 /usr/include 目录中,那么在编译的时候需要用 -I 参数指定其路径。由于同一个库在不同系统上可能位于不同的目录下,用户安装库的时候也可以将库安装在不同的目录下...

2010-02-07 17:22:11 149

原创 想找项目做

生活时时需要动力,我们不甘平庸,不愿就这样了。想找项目来做,是啊,该上路了,即使这样的互联网让人愈感不安。[img]http://dl.iteye.com/upload/attachment/201786/0fb5ffe5-3350-35c1-a181-5088919051bb.jpg[/img]...

2010-02-02 01:17:24 136

原创 GWT通信机制初探

GWT RPC:GWT提供类似Swing的界面开发模式(基于UI组件重用,事件注册及监听等机制),遵循此开发模式的客户端Java代码将被编译为Javascript代码(并优化,压缩),以运行于客户端浏览器中。然而,客户端Java代码不仅仅包含即将呈现在HTML页面中的UI元素,还包含提供服务的接口和相对应的代理接口(实现异步调用服务),服务接口声明即将被客户端通过RPC调用的方法。服务器端实现...

2010-01-29 10:30:19 280

原创 SVG代码示例

SVG:Scala Vector GraphicsSVG in HTML:[code="html"]

2010-01-11 16:24:41 280

原创 【转】vmstat 命令的用法说明

本文转自:[url]http://www.eygle.com/digest/2007/07/vmstat_man_page.html[/url][size=medium]用途[/size]报告虚拟内存统计信息。[size=medium]语法[/size]vmstat [ -f ] [ -i ] [ -s ] [ -I ] [ -t ] [ -v ] [ PhysicalVolu...

2010-01-04 16:51:26 105

原创 【转】set uid, set gid, sticky bit详解

【本文转自】:[url]http://space.doit.com.cn/51460/viewspace-14008.html[/url]*nix系统文件权限引入了属主uid和属组gid及其余other的概念 ,如果是一个可执行文件, 一般只拥有调用该文件的执行权限用户具有的运行的权力, 而setuid, setgid 可以来改变这种设置.setuid: 设置使文件在执行阶段具有文件所...

2009-12-30 17:32:05 156

原创 【转】Bash shortcuts

转载自: [url]http://www.dbanotes.net/techmemo/shell_shortcut.html[/url] 这篇[url=http://linuxhelp.blogspot.com/2005/08/bash-shell-shortcuts.html] Bash Shell Shortcuts [/url]的快捷键总结的非常好。值得学习。下面内容大多数是拷贝...

2009-11-22 23:47:54 175

Notepad2快捷键

Notepad2是一款小巧、快速、开源的文本编辑器,它支持几乎所有主流语言的语法加亮显示。而它也已成为本人必不可少的工具。Notepad2主页:[url]http://sourceforge.net/projects/notepad2[/url]快捷键列表(按常用级别高低排序):[table]|Ctrl + b| 定位至当前代码块的开始或结尾位置|Ctrl + m| 换行(与U...

2009-11-19 08:53:46 1299

SixthSense Technology ----- Integrating Information With The Real World

也许许多人看到来自微软Office实验室的一段[url=http://apple4.us/2009/05/microsoft-office-labs-vision-2019.html][color=green]“愿景2019”[/color][/url]畅想2019年人类活动的视频时,不禁一震,这不是好莱坞巨制科幻片中的所惯用的一些场景吗? 这样的场景讲述的是依托数字多媒体等技术,人类现实生活是如...

2009-11-18 21:27:58 222

二进制数的一些有用特性

摘自:《编程卓越之道:深入计算机系统》二进制数有一些很有趣的东西可以学习,而且它们对我们的开发会带来很大的帮助,这些特性是:1、如果一个二进制(整型)数的第零位的值是一,那么这个数就是奇数;而如果该位是零,那么这个数就是偶数。2、如果一个二进制数的低端n位都是零,那么这个数可以被2n整除。3、如果一个二进制数的第n位是一,而其他各位都是零,那么这个数等于2n。4、如...

2009-09-27 00:34:49 261

有关Google的两条消息

有关于Google的两条消息:1、Google发布了针对IE的Chrome Frame插件,此插件可以直接将IE的内核阉割改换成Chrome内核,IE只留下了外观。2、Google发布了介绍HTML5新特性的视频。主要讲述了: [list][*]* 通过Canvas标签实现的网络矢量图和SVG(Scalable Vector Graphics可缩放的矢量图形)[*] * 基...

2009-09-26 22:50:46 125

Windows和Unix下的换行符

SeeBeyond(Sun公司的系统集成产品)服务器是在Sun Solaris机器上的。今天我们这个新项目组的成员们基于Windows利用EAI技术(Enterprise Application Integration)开发简单的系统集成应用,需要将类似于JavaBean的持久化对象(存储在纯文本文件中,利用分隔符进行字段和对象记录的分割)上传至服务器指定目录中。业务逻辑的实现、文件读入和...

2009-09-24 23:35:05 473

原创 相信未来

[size=x-large]相信未来 [/size] [size=medium]当蜘蛛网无情地查封了我的炉台当灰烬的余烟叹息着贫困的悲哀我依然固执地铺平失望的灰烬用美丽的雪花写下:相信未来当我的紫葡萄化为深秋的露水当我的鲜花依偎在别人的情怀我依然固执地用凝霜的枯藤在凄凉的大地上写下:相信未来我要用手指那涌向天边的排浪我要用手掌那托住太阳的大海...

2009-09-02 19:40:19 148

原创 入手《Effective Java》第二版,些许失望

早已耳闻《Effective Java》大名,是众多Java程序员进阶的必备书籍,由Google的Java架构师Joshua Bloch所著,讲述Java技术中的78条“最佳实践”。再加上本书又有Javaeye高人YuLimin参与翻译,故在Amazon上买了这本书,今天到货。 怀着激动的心情开始从前往后读这本书,可是刚开始阅读便发现一些句子翻译的不尽理想。然后在网上下载英文版电...

2009-09-01 23:53:09 1623 1

原创 原码、补码和反码

【文章转自】:[url=http://dev.csdn.net/develop/article/17/17680.shtm]CSDN技术中心fengzi_zhu博客[/url] 数值在计算机中表示形式为机器数,计算机只能识别0和1,使用的是二进制,而在日常生活中人们使用的是十进制,"正如亚里士多德早就指出的那样,今天十进制的广泛采用,只不过我们绝大多数人生来具有10个手指头这个解剖学...

2009-08-23 14:53:42 131

Java中禁止的包名(Prohibited package name)

由于定义了以java开始的包(java.mypackage),编译时错误:[code="java"]java.lang.SecurityException: Prohibited package name: java.mypackage at java.lang.ClassLoader.preDefineClass(ClassLoader.java:479) at java.lan...

2009-08-19 00:18:27 511

原创 第一份工作步入正轨

自那场场散伙饭之后,一切都悄然进入正轨,远的近的迟的早的都开始乐观而充满期待的度过每一天,正所谓上班族。再也不会像刚逝去的离别散场中的醉酒当歌,再也不会有有青春便可以随便搞的兴致了。因为谁都很清楚,在这个无法逆转的离别之后,必须扛起以前不曾有过的责任,必须考虑如何生与活,必须背负理想实现自我。没有仪式、没有兴奋,我的工作在平淡的7月6日开始。由于是新的基地,人员配置并不齐全,入...

2009-07-30 00:25:41 275

Life@work

A heart to win and to enjoy life@work.

2009-07-29 08:24:45 96

Oracle system表空间满的暂定解决方法

数据库用的是Oracle Express 10.2版本的。利用Oracle Text做全文检索应用,创建用户yxl时没有初始化默认表空间,在系统开发过程中我利用yxl在数据库中创建了7个Context或Ctxcat类型索引。开始利用这些索引进行查询的时候速度很慢,在控制台查看了一下,发现system表空间居然占了99.69%。下面是表空间占用情况的截图:[img]/upload/attac...

2009-06-10 23:34:37 342

原创 Eclipse中10个最有用的快捷键组合

本文转自:[url=http://techbbs.zol.com.cn/frmView.php?frameon=yes&subcatid=8&bookid=918&ref0=http://app.iteye.com/feed/all]ZOL技术论坛[/url]一个Eclipse骨灰级开发者总结了他认为最有用但又不太为人所知的快捷键组合。通过这些组合可以更加容易的浏览源代码,使得整体的开...

2009-06-04 13:18:37 134

Log4j for Tomcat5.5

在Tomcat5.5之前,可以通过server.xml下的子节点配置日志。但Tomcat5.5已经不再提供这种配置方式,取而代之的,Tomcat采用由Sun公司提供的日志框架java.util.logging,它被采用在JDK日志机制中,提供对每个虚拟机的日志记录(per-JVM logging)。Tomcat扩展实现了java.util.logging,称之为JULI,它通过对LogManage...

2009-05-31 13:41:33 106

Javascript实现树结构,欢迎拍砖

近日写一个文章检索系统,需要用到一个树来动态显示数据库中存储的文章类别,于是自己操刀用JS编写。虽然实现了预期功能,但代码结构和实现逻辑(或说设计思路)并不是很理想,希望各位能够给些建议,谢谢!先看下效果:[img]/upload/attachment/109088/e0d9d292-292a-3573-81fc-9f33da1fabaa.jpg[/img]从数据库获取文章类别...

2009-05-29 12:04:37 185

利用JDBC操作Oracle CLOB和BLOB类型数据

对LOB数据(包括CLOB BLOB NCLOB BFILE类型)操作的插入操作步骤:插入空值-->获取空值列及更新锁-->更新LOB字段。通过查询操作得到的LOB类型数据处理要点:首先利用LOB字段数据获取InputStream或OutputStream对象,然后根据需要对其进行操作,若需提取数据则获取InputStream对象,若需更新LOB字段数据,则获取OutputStream对象...

2009-05-11 09:41:14 202

解决eclipse3.4下错误:Exception starting filter struts2

项目中用到struts2,跟以前用到过的struts有很大区别,在用的过程中碰到了很多朋友碰到的问题[quote]严重: Exception starting filter struts2java.lang.ClassNotFoundException: org.apache.struts2.dispatcher.FilterDispatcher[/quote]google之后看到很多...

2009-05-04 12:26:47 272

深夜,有关于青春散场

已经有好长时间没有这么晚还坐在电脑前了,这个深夜,外面淅淅沥沥的雨一直没停,有种想写点东西的激动。打开编辑器,脑海却又空白了许久。不论是对自己还是对朋友,一直以来我总是习惯于把自己装在一个隔绝的容器内,沟通是被阻隔的,每时每刻只是对自己的躯壳讲着一些杂七杂八的事情。我试图捅破这颗容器,去寻找到一扇窗口,让信任的人看到我的诉求,让自己听到自己的回音。这样一个安静的深夜,或许才是流露内心和倾...

2009-05-01 03:23:35 114

Ubuntu,where freedom goes on

Right now,I'm just enjoying Southern Africa's wonderful landscape,where the Ubuntu takes me to.It feels like wondering in the kingdom of freedom.Yes,I just installed the Ubuntu9.04 "Jaunty".With n...

2009-04-24 12:16:16 87

JDBC高级编程:操作结果集

自JDBC2.0之后,可滚动(Scrollable)结果集出现,利用可滚动结果集你可以在结果集中前后移动,并可以跳到任意行,后者通过绝对行号和当前行号的偏移量都能够实现。可滚动结果集可以“感知”到用于填充它的数据库表中行的修改,这意味着它对于数据库中的某些修改是敏感的,这称为敏感的可滚动(sensitive scrollable)结果集。结果集也可以用于更新、删除、插入底层数据库表中...

2009-04-23 10:26:11 142

原创 甲骨文收购升阳, 学习苹果好榜样?

本文转自:[url=http://apple4.us/2009/04/post-158.html]apple4us 木遥[/url]今天业界最大的新闻是[url=http://tech.sina.com.cn/focus/ibm_sun/index.shtml]甲骨文正式宣布收购升阳[/url]。之前传言得沸沸扬扬的IBM收购意向已于两周前被撤回。这无疑是近年来最重要的信息产业...

2009-04-21 09:56:00 165

[视频] Evan Williams:意外的应用如何成就了Twitter飞速发展

[url=http://www.ted.com/talks/view/id/473]Evan Williams: How Twitter's spectacular growth is being driven by unexpected uses[/url](由于JaveEye无法以object标签嵌入多媒体,故附上链接)Evan Williams: Evan Will...

2009-04-20 11:05:00 145

原创 Java动态绑定探讨

本文转 “子 孑” 博客:[url]http://zhangjunhd.blog.51cto.com/113473/49452[/url]运行时绑定也叫动态绑定,它是一种调用对象方法的机制。Java调用对象方法时,一般采用运行时绑定机制。1.Java的方法调用过程编译器查看对象的声明类型和方法名(对象变量的声明类型)。通过声明类型找到方法列表。编译器查看调用方法时提供的参数类型...

2009-04-20 09:26:49 295

[视频]中移动-联想OPhone发布会上沙子作画

随着中国3G网络如火如荼的兴起,一股移动互联网的风潮亦开始萌动。中国移动联手联想研发OPhone手机,实为抢占先机。之前中移动发布的G3标志颇有点神韵,今日看到OPhone发布会上利用沙子作画,背光蓝色调让一个个现代符号的画面盎然生动。如下为作画视频:[flash=480,400]http://player.youku.com/player.php/sid/XODUxODQz...

2009-04-18 13:53:44 125

原创 深入浅出REST

作者 Stefan Tilkov 译者 苑永凯不知你是否意识到,围绕着什么才是实现异构的应用到应用通信的“正确”方式,一场争论正进行的如火如荼:虽然当前主流的方式明显地集中在基于SOAP、WSDL和WS-*规范的Web Services领域,但也有少数人用细小但洪亮的声音主张说更好的方式是REST,表述性状态转移(REpresentational State Transfer)的简称。在本...

2009-04-17 22:06:48 112

原创 理解REST软件架构

作者 骆古道一种思维方式影响了软件行业的发展。REST软件架构是当今世界上最成功的互联网的超媒体分布式系统。它让人们真正理解我们的网络协议HTTP本来面貌。它正在成为网络服务的主流技术,同时也正在改变互联网的网络软件开发的全新思维方式。AJAX技术和Rails框架把REST软件架构思想真正地在实际中很好表现出来。今天微软也已经应用REST并且提出把我们现有的网络变成为一个语义网,这种网络将...

2009-04-17 19:57:25 92

Notepad++

开源的一个记事本,扩展多种编程语言的格式检查。<br>完全可以替代微软记事本

2007-07-25

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除